Episode Synopsis
As SLP’s, we work with students with many different diagnoses and needs educationally. It is important for us to understand those needs so we can best help them. In this episode of SLP Coffee Talk, I sat down with Michael McLeod to discuss all things ADHD and executive functioning, as well as how we can help these students in our therapy practice. Michael McLeod is a Speech-Language Pathologist and ADHD/Executive Function Specialist. He is the owner of GrowNOW Therapy in Philadelphia, PA, and the creator of the Internal Language Model for Executive Functions. Michael has traveled internationally training parents and professionals about the ADHD-Language Connection! Research on ADHD is ongoing and we continue to learn more about it all the time. As we get new information, we are seeing that ADHD has a lot to do with our wheelhouse: language. Tune in as Michael shares what ADHD is exactly, the impact it has on self-talk and executive functioning skills, and how we can help our students improve their quality of life by improving their executive functioning skills in speech therapy.
